The Fullwood Foundation, Inc., is a non-profit IRS-501(c)(3) tax exempt corporation and Registered Maryland Charitable Organization, founded in 1984.

The Foundation raises funds to support numerous educational initiatives designed to provide youth with scholarships for higher education to empower them to successful careers, awards special grants to organizations that provide vital and exemplary human services, and publicly honors individuals whose humanitarian deeds substantially improve the quality of life of the citizens of the State of Maryland.

The Fullwood Foundation charity projects include:

The Annual "Student Essay Contest" and

"Ambassador of the Year" Awards Dinner;

The "First Time Experiences For Children" Project; and

The Annual Choir Extravaganza.

The Annual Fullwood Benefit and Recognition Breakfast raises thousands of dollars to support a variety of community-wide causes, and has awarded hundreds of thousands of dollars and scholarships during its 11 years. With an annual attendance of more than 2,000, The Fullwood Breakfast is acclaimed as the largest and most spectacular fund raising event of its kind in the State of Maryland.

Elnora and Harlow Fullwood, Jr., owners of Fullwood Foods, Inc., which includes some of the most successful KFC franchises in the USA., have contributed more than $110,000 to Coppin State College and have pledged $35,000 to support Coppin's current Capital Campaign.
